Product Introduction
**VS3508AE-VB** is a single P-Channel MOSFET in a DFN8 (3x3) package with low on-resistance and high maximum drain current capability, making it ideal for high-efficiency power management and switching applications. The maximum drain-source voltage (VDS) of this MOSFET is -30V, the maximum gate-source voltage (VGS) is ±20V, the turn-on voltage (Vth) is -2.5V, and the on-resistance (RDS(ON)) is 18mΩ at VGS=4.5V and 11mΩ at VGS=10V, ensuring its efficient current conduction capability. These features of **VS3508AE-VB** enable it to perform well in low-voltage, high-current applications, and can meet the needs of multiple fields such as power transmission, switching regulation, and power management.

Detailed parameter description
- **Package type**: DFN8(3x3)
- **Configuration**: Single P-Channel
- **Maximum drain-source voltage (VDS)**: -30V
- **Maximum gate-source voltage (VGS)**: ±20V
- **Throughput voltage (Vth)**: -2.5V
- **On-resistance (RDS(ON))**:
- 18mΩ @ VGS = 4.5V
- 11mΩ @ VGS = 10V
- **Maximum drain current (ID)**: -45A
- **Technology**: Trench
The low RDS(ON) characteristics of the **VS3508AE-VB** minimize power loss in the on state, thereby improving efficiency and reducing heat generation. In addition, the MOSFET has a high drain current capability, suitable for high current load applications, and has a low on-resistance, capable of stable operation under different voltage conditions.
Domain and module applications:
Application fields and module examples
1. **Power management and DC-DC converter**:
In power management systems, **VS3508AE-VB** is widely used in DC-DC converters, linear regulators, and switching power supply modules as an efficient switching element. MOSFET can effectively regulate the flow of current, minimize power loss, and improve the overall efficiency of the system. Due to its low on-resistance, it can reduce power loss in the system and is suitable for power management applications with high efficiency requirements such as battery-driven portable devices and power conversion modules.
2. **Battery management system**:
**VS3508AE-VB** acts as a load switch in the battery management system, which can control the battery charging and discharging process, avoid overcharging or over-discharging, and effectively manage the battery status. It is suitable for scenarios such as mobile devices, power tools, and electric vehicles that require efficient battery management, ensuring that the battery is within the normal working range, thereby extending battery life and improving energy efficiency.
3. **Load switch and overcurrent protection circuit**:
**VS3508AE-VB** can be used as an important component in load switch and overcurrent protection circuit. It can quickly respond to current changes, control the opening and closing of load switches, and protect circuits from damage under overcurrent conditions. It is particularly suitable for current-sensitive devices and power systems, such as computer power supplies, TVs, audio and other consumer electronic products, to ensure safe and stable operation of the system.
